Farmington Crusin’ the Grand is a beloved local tradition that brings together classic car enthusiasts and community members for an afternoon of automotive appreciation. Held in the Village Commons parking lot along Grand River Avenue, this event showcases a variety of vintage and custom vehicles. It serves as a fantastic opportunity for neighbors to connect, share stories about their favorite rides, and enjoy the summer atmosphere in the heart of Farmington, Michigan.
